Production Budget
A financial plan that estimates the costs associated with the production process, including materials, labor, and overhead, within a specific period.
Direct Materials Purchases Budget
A budget that estimates the quantities of direct materials to be purchased to support budgeted production and desired inventory levels.
Sales Budget
A financial plan that estimates future sales volumes and revenues.
Capital Expenditures Budget
A budget that plans for investments in long-term assets like equipment, buildings, and machinery essential for the business's operations and growth.
